Output 94635211838b6e18f7f7071bf9e74a1f1877e89f0b6ea9afecd351c5401ae995:0

value
12639011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 835416f95c47bf891e5c8a84331e40c07fd563bc OP_EQUAL
address
3DfRBLAepVkdQJodjc7dJvvAzVLYaEjqzD
transaction
94635211838b6e18f7f7071bf9e74a1f1877e89f0b6ea9afecd351c5401ae995
spent
true